Introduction to Strip Till Equipment
Strip till equipment is a type of farm machinery designed to improve soil health and reduce erosion. This equipment is used in conservation tillage, a farming practice that aims to minimize the disturbance of soil while still preparing it for planting. By using strip till equipment, farmers can reduce their environmental impact while also improving the productivity of their land.
The main goal of strip till equipment is to create a narrow strip of tilled soil where seeds can be planted, while leaving the surrounding soil undisturbed. This approach helps to preserve soil organic matter, reduce soil compaction, and promote healthy soil biota. Strip till equipment typically consists of a toolbar with row units that are spaced to match the width of the crops being planted.
Strip till equipment can be used in a variety of farming operations, from small-scale vegetable production to large-scale row crop farming. The equipment is often used in conjunction with other conservation tillage practices, such as no-till and reduced-till farming. By adopting these practices, farmers can reduce their fuel consumption, lower their labor costs, and create a more sustainable farming system.

Benefits of Strip Till Equipment
Strip till equipment offers several benefits to farmers, including reduced soil erosion and improved soil health. By only tilling a narrow strip of soil, these machines help to preserve the soil’s organic matter and structure, leading to better water infiltration and aeration. This, in turn, can lead to healthier plants and higher yields. Additionally, strip till equipment can help to reduce soil compaction, which can be a major problem in fields with heavy machinery traffic.
One of the most significant benefits of strip till equipment is its ability to reduce soil erosion. By leaving most of the soil undisturbed, these machines help to prevent soil particles from being washed or blown away. This is especially important in areas with heavy rainfall or strong winds, where soil erosion can be a major problem. Furthermore, strip till equipment can help to reduce the amount of sediment that enters nearby waterways, which can help to protect aquatic ecosystems.
Another benefit of strip till equipment is its ability to improve soil fertility. By only tilling a narrow strip of soil, these machines help to minimize soil disturbance, which can lead to a loss of nutrients. Additionally, strip till equipment can help to incorporate organic matter into the soil, such as crop residues or compost, which can provide nutrients to plants. This can lead to healthier plants and higher yields, while also reducing the need for synthetic fertilizers.

Types of Strip Till Equipment
There are several types of strip till equipment available, each with its own unique features and benefits. One of the most common types is the single-row strip tiller, which is designed for small to medium-sized farms. These machines typically consist of a single toolbar with one or two rows of tilling tools, and are often pulled behind a tractor or other vehicle.
Another type of strip till equipment is the multi-row strip tiller, which is designed for larger farms or those with more complex soil types. These machines typically consist of a toolbar with multiple rows of tilling tools, and may be equipped with additional features such as fertilizer applicators or seed planters. Multi-row strip tillers are often more expensive than single-row machines, but can provide greater efficiency and flexibility in a variety of soil conditions.
Some strip till equipment is also designed for specific soil types or conditions. For example, some machines are designed for use in rocky or sandy soils, where traditional tillage methods may be difficult or ineffective. Others are designed for use in areas with high levels of soil compaction, where deep tillage is necessary to break up compacted layers.
In addition to these types, there are also several accessories and attachments available for strip till equipment, such as row cleaners and fertilizer injectors. These can help to improve the performance and versatility of the machine, and provide additional benefits such as improved soil fertility and reduced weed pressure.

Strip Till Equipment Maintenance and Troubleshooting
Regular maintenance is essential to ensure the optimal performance and longevity of strip till equipment. This includes tasks such as lubricating moving parts, checking and replacing worn or damaged components, and cleaning the machine to prevent corrosion and wear. Additionally, the machine’s operating system and safety features should be regularly inspected and tested to ensure they are functioning properly.
One of the most common issues with strip till equipment is clogging or blockages in the tilling tools or toolbar. This can be caused by a variety of factors, including wet or sticky soil, debris or rocks in the field, or worn or damaged components. To troubleshoot this issue, farmers can try cleaning or replacing the affected components, or adjusting the machine’s operating settings to improve its performance in difficult soil conditions.
Another common issue is uneven or incomplete tillage, which can be caused by a variety of factors including incorrect machine settings, uneven terrain, or worn or damaged components. To troubleshoot this issue, farmers can try adjusting the machine’s operating settings, checking and replacing worn or damaged components, or using additional attachments or accessories to improve the machine’s performance.
In addition to these common issues, strip till equipment can also be subject to more complex problems such as hydraulic system failures or electrical malfunctions. In these cases, it may be necessary to consult the machine’s operating manual or contact a professional mechanic or technician for assistance. What is strip till equipment and how does it work?
Strip till equipment is a type of agricultural machinery designed to prepare the soil for planting by tillating a narrow strip of land while leaving the rest of the soil undisturbed. This approach helps to reduce soil disturbance, preserve soil moisture, and promote healthy soil biota. By using strip till equipment, farmers can create a fertile and conducive environment for their crops to grow, which can lead to improved yields and better crop quality.
The working principle of strip till equipment involves the use of a combination of tools, such as coulters, disks, and row cleaners, to loosen and aerate the soil in a narrow strip. The equipment is typically attached to a tractor and is designed to operate at a specific depth and spacing, depending on the type of crop being planted. As the equipment moves through the field, it creates a seedbed that is free of debris and clods, allowing for smooth and even seed placement. This can be particularly beneficial for crops that require a high degree of soil precision, such as corn and soybeans.

What types of crops are best suited for strip till equipment?
Strip till equipment is versatile and can be used for a variety of crops, including corn, soybeans, wheat, and sugar beets. However, it is particularly well-suited for crops that require a high degree of soil precision, such as corn and soybeans. These crops benefit from the smooth and even seedbed created by the strip till equipment, which allows for optimal seed placement and emergence. Additionally, strip till equipment can be used for crops that are sensitive to soil compaction, such as wheat and sugar beets.
The type of crop being planted will also influence the choice of strip till equipment. For example, farmers planting corn may require a more aggressive tillage system to handle heavy residue and create a smooth seedbed. In contrast, farmers planting soybeans may require a less aggressive system to avoid damaging the soil and promoting weed growth. Ultimately, the choice of strip till equipment will depend on the specific needs of the crop being planted, as well as the soil type and condition.
